BBC COAST - 'the perfect shot of a polar bear'

On Tuesday 25th August BBC Coast travelled the spectacular shoreline of Norway to discover Britain's age-old link to the land of the fjords. Nick Crane took a trip over one of Norway's most beautiful fjords to witness the great ice sheets. Theirs was the force which once sculpted Britain's own landscape; in Norway they are still at work gouging out the mighty glacial valleys. Whilst in the frozen landscape of Svalbard, wildlife photographer Jason Roberts was on the hunt for the perfect shot of a polar bear.
